The campaign for this U.S. House seat in this election year is a very high interest race; it only happens once every 12 years, where this race is at the top of the ticket.

This year is very historic in terms of the social agenda of a new administration. Jobs are a high priority and will remain the highest priority for my campaign. To reiterate my sentiments on the campaign trail: I support the Employee Free Choice Act and I believe the card check bill would have done great things for the average person to advance in their employment and unionize their workplace.

I support the passage of the recent 18B jobs bill, however, I believe more needs to be done. I support the 155B jobs bill passed by the House last December and hope the Senate will move forward with the same commitment to address the high unemployment of our citizens.
